编程,作为现代科技的核心驱动力,已经成为众多领域不可或缺的技能。然而,面对浩如烟海的编程资料,如何高效地破解编程难题,掌握有效的编程资料库,成为了许多编程爱好者和专业人士的共同挑战。本文将为您提供全方位的编程指南,帮助您破解编程难题,轻松驾驭码海。
一、编程难题的破解之道
1. 理解问题本质
面对编程难题,首先要做的是理解问题的本质。这包括:
- 明确需求:确保你完全理解了问题的背景和目标。
- 分析问题:将复杂问题分解为更小的、可管理的部分。
2. 研究现有解决方案
- 查阅资料:利用搜索引擎、技术论坛和博客等资源,查找类似问题的解决方案。
- 代码示例:参考优秀的开源项目,学习他人的代码实现。
3. 编程实践与调试
- 编写代码:根据问题需求,编写相应的代码。
- 调试:使用调试工具,逐步检查代码的执行过程,找出并修复错误。
4. 代码优化与重构
- 优化性能:关注代码的执行效率,进行性能优化。
- 重构代码:改进代码结构,提高代码的可读性和可维护性。
二、码海编程资料库的构建
1. 资料库的分类与整理
- 分类:根据编程语言、技术领域和项目类型,对资料进行分类。
- 整理:将资料整理成易于查找和使用的格式。
2. 资料库的更新与维护
- 定期更新:关注新技术和新工具,及时更新资料库。
- 维护:定期清理无效或过时的资料。
3. 资料库的共享与协作
- 共享:将资料库分享给团队成员或社区,促进知识交流。
- 协作:鼓励团队成员共同维护和更新资料库。
三、编程学习资源推荐
1. 编程书籍
- 《代码大全》
- 《重构:改善既有代码的设计》
- 《设计模式:可复用面向对象软件的基础》
2. 在线课程
- Coursera
- Udemy
- edX
3. 技术社区
- Stack Overflow
- GitHub
- CSDN
四、总结
破解编程难题,掌握码海编程资料库,需要我们不断学习、实践和总结。通过本文的全方位编程指南,相信您已经对如何应对编程挑战有了更清晰的认识。祝您在编程的道路上越走越远,成为一名优秀的程序员!
